    Processed beetroot (Beta vulgaris L.) as a natural antioxidant in mayonnaise: Effects on physical stability, texture and sensory attributes

    Get PDF
    AbstractThe oxidative and physical stability of the reformulated mayonnaise with processed beetroot was investigated and compared with a control (mayonnaise without beetroot) and a commercially available product. Processing of beetroot had an impact on the structural integrity of the antioxidants present. Microwaving (960W for 7min) was advantageous for preserving the betalain and polyphenol content of beetroot compared to roasting (180°C for 90min) and boiling (100°C for 30min). The oxidative stability of mayonnaise samples was determined by Rancimat and the thiobarbituric (TBA) assay. The addition of microwaved beetroot significantly enhanced the oxidative stability of mayonnaise at the end of a storage period of 4 weeks (4°C). Although no significant differences (p>0.05) were detected between the mayonnaise samples containing beetroot and the commercial control, the latter was less susceptible to oxidation during storage. The turbiscan stability index (TSI) revealed that the commercial mayonnaise was less prone to destabilization phenomena. All the textural parameters increased with the incorporation of beetroot. The sensory evaluation revealed that, with the exception of graininess and uniformity, most of the sensory attributes are preserved if not improved with the addition of beetroot

    Varietal description of two genotypes of manzano chili pepper (Capsicum pubescens Ruiz & Pav.)

    Get PDF
    Objective: the objective of this research work was to obtain the varietal description of two varieties of chile manzano in Las Montañas in the center of Veracruz, México. Design/methodology/approach: the varietal characterization module was established under greenhouse conditions at the Centro de Bachillerato Tecnológico Agropecuario No. 99 in the municipality of Coscomatepec de Bravo. The recorded descriptors were in accordance with the International of Plant Genetic Resources Institute for Capsicum and the Graphic Handbook for Variety Description of manzano hot pepper. The plants were characterized from the seedling to the adult plant. The agronomic management of the crop was carried out in accordance with the manual for the production of manzano hot pepper in Las Montañas of the state of Veracruz. Results: all qualitative descriptors were constant for the two varieties MEXUVNE1-15-C2 and MEXUVCU1-16-C2 from seedling to fruiting; in contrast, there were dissimilarities in plant height, stem, leaf, flower, fruit and seed dimensions. Limitations of the study/implications: the pandemic caused by COVID-19 was the main limitation so that some descriptors were not recorded in a timely manner as indicated in the Graphic Handbook.
